Ghana Tax Compliance Deadlines each individual small business need to Know
corporations operating in Ghana in 2026 should adjust to the next crucial tax deadlines. company profits Tax Self-Assessment is due to the Ghana profits Authority by 31 March each and every year for your earlier year of evaluation. yearly Returns must be filed with the Registrar basic's Office by thirty April yearly. PAYE needs to be remitted into the GRA because of the 15th of each month subsequent the wage payment thirty day period. VAT returns are because of on the last Functioning day of each month. Withholding tax have to be remitted by the fifteenth of each month pursuing the expense transaction thirty day period. SSNIT contributions have to be submitted by the 14th of each month for every worker over the payroll.

Withholding Tax in Ghana: The Obligation Most firms pass up
Withholding tax in Ghana is often a tax deducted at resource through the paying celebration in advance of money is remitted on the receiver. each business enterprise in Ghana that pays a contractor, expert or service provider for do the job finished would be the withholding agent. The having to pay corporation is liable for deducting the tax, Keeping it and remitting it towards the GRA with the 15th of the following month.
critical withholding tax costs in Ghana in 2026 are as follows. Goods supplied by resident companies or persons: three p.c. Specialist and complex expert services by citizens: seven.5 per cent. Professional and technical expert services by non-citizens: 25 p.c. Construction and performs contracts: 5 per cent. Commercial hire: 15 per cent. Residential rent: eight per cent. curiosity payments to non-people: eight p.c. Dividends paid to shareholders: eight %.

VAT in Ghana: What modified in January 2026
the worth Added Tax Modification Act 2025 (Act 1151) arrived into effect on 1 January 2026 and introduced important variations to Ghana's VAT program. The three percent VAT Flat fee Scheme was abolished and changed by using a Unified VAT program. The new standard rate comprises VAT at fifteen per cent, NHIL at two.five p.c and GETFund Levy at 2.five percent, giving a total effective level of 20 per cent. The 1 p.c Covid-19 Levy was also faraway from VAT computation.
The registration threshold for enterprises providing only goods improved from GHS 200,000 to GHS 750,000. nonetheless, there is absolutely no registration threshold for service providers. All corporations delivering services in Ghana need to register for VAT no matter their profits degree. current service vendors who weren't Earlier needed to copyright will have to accomplish that inside of thirty days of the helpful date.

organization Registration and once-a-year Returns in Ghana
every single company incorporated in Ghana is required to file annual returns With all the Registrar common's Office each year, regardless of whether the corporate traded through that 12 months. A dormant corporation with no income and no personnel continues to be legally obligated to file. lacking yearly returns ends in a penalty and, if unresolved, can lead to the company name becoming struck within the register.
yearly returns are a completely different obligation from tax filing Using the GRA. Many companies in Ghana are existing with their GRA tax obligations but have outstanding yearly returns with the Registrar normal, which creates compliance gaps that floor all through lender facility purposes, authorities tender procedures and investor research.

Payroll administration and SSNIT Compliance in Ghana
every single employer in Ghana is required to register each new worker with SSNIT inside thirty times of their commencement date and to remit every month SSNIT contributions because of the 14th of the next month. Deducting SSNIT from worker salaries is not really the same as remitting it. each obligations are individual and both have penalties for non-compliance.
PAYE should be calculated effectively from The present GRA tax bands for each personnel. mistakes in PAYE calculation, which include incorrect remedy of allowances and failure to update tax bands when salaries adjust, compound silently over months and area as significant liabilities throughout GRA audits. exactly what is the corporate earnings tax amount in Ghana in 2026? The regular company cash flow tax amount in Ghana is 25 percent. selected sectors like agriculture, tourism and export-oriented cost-free zone enterprises benefit from lessened fees and tax vacations less than Ghana's expense incentive framework.
How do I register for VAT in Ghana? corporations providing products in Ghana must sign-up for VAT when taxable materials exceed GHS 750,000 in almost any twelve-month period of time. All assistance suppliers ought to copyright no matter revenue degree. Registration is done with the Ghana profits Authority. exactly what is the penalty for late PAYE in Ghana? Late PAYE appeals to a penalty of ten % of the remarkable amount moreover fascination on the Bank of Ghana financial coverage level as well as 5 p.c for each annum. How long does enterprise registration get in Ghana? enterprise registration within the Registrar normal's Division in Ghana commonly requires among three and 10 Functioning days for a private constrained business, based on doc completeness as well as the workload with the Registrar's Place of work. Can a overseas investor own land in Ghana? international investors can't own freehold land in Ghana. they're able to obtain leasehold pursuits for periods of as much as 50 decades, renewable for a further fifty years. overseas buyers should have interaction a Ghana-skilled attorney to critique all land and assets documentation just before any acquisition.
